Yao Ming

Yao Ming is one of the most famous and successful basketball players in the world. He was born in Shanghai, China in 1980.He is 2.26 meters tall. When he was 9 years old, he began to play basketball. Then he joined in the national team at the age of 18.When he was 22 years old, he joined NBA. After a few years, he retired from NBA in 2011. Then he became the boss of Shanghai Basketball team. He makes Shanghai basketball team better and better.

Yao Ming likes playing basketball and reading. And he is very polite and friendly to others. Young people like Yao Ming very much. He is the pride of China. I like admire him very much.
